      @strawberry-3-141 That i know but i want it to be delayed as it is a live stream that loads and plays on auto.
      So i rely need it as it is consuming cpu power when it loads and than the result is that my RPI hangs and needs to restart.

      Or if it is any function / Module so i can manage the stream by a mouse click or other as i can delete the line that turns the stream on automatically.

        @wizz you could enhance the start function with a timeout which sets a flag delayload and calls the updatedom function, then in getdom you check if the delayload flag is set, if so then render the iframe

            @strawberry-3.141 would you happen to sit on an example of this sorcery you speak of? I’m looking to add a delay to my newsfeed, as I have 3 different feeds, and it’s quite disorienting when all 3 reload at the same time.

              @Advokaten

              Module.register("iFrame",{
                // Default module config.
                defaults: {
                  height:"300px",
                  width:"100%"
                },
              
                start: function(){
                  setTimeout(() => {this.delayLoad = true; this.updateDom();}, 2 * 60 * 1000);
                },
              
                // Override dom generator.
                getDom: function() {
                  var iframe = document.createElement("IFRAME");
              
                  if(this.delayLoad){
                    iframe.style = "border:0";
                    iframe.width = this.config.width;
                    iframe.height = this.config.height;
                    iframe.src = this.config.url;
                  }
                  return iframe;
                }
              });
